  • 2 Questions about rank.

    1) How long does it take for an average player (I consider myself average) to get 1700 points on standard servers? None of that IO medic crap, too easy imo.

    2) Which unlock should I get next? I dont play Anti-Tank, so I have a choice between any 2 of these:

    G36C - Is it that much of an improvement?
    SCAR-L - Want this, but is it worth getting after the G36?
    L96 - Not much to say, but this looks awesome
    M95 - Again, looks incredibly useful
    MG36 - Dont really like this, but then again, Im sure someone here can give me some tips
    F2000 - Also dont find this attractive.

  • #2
    Re: 2 Questions about rank.

    figure about an hour per 100 points at first. It can be a lot more (and even less).

    Go with the unlock for the kit you play the most. I love the G36C and also the SCAR-L and F2000. I play a lot of AT and found the DAO to be it's saving grace. If you ever get into the engineer character, the Jackhammer is good as well.

                          • #14
                            Re: 2 Questions about rank.

                            Doesn't matter. Whether you get 100 points in a 30 minute game or 200 points in an hour long game, your SPM is the same. The good thing about longer games is if you are specifically trying for an In A Round award, the longer the round, the easier it is for you.

                            • #15
                              Re: 2 Questions about rank.

                              Hi raidyr. Seen you on 2142 forum. Your map choice should be decided by what kits you wanna play. Some maps are just very vehicle dominated and are best played as AT/Engi. Also there is a difference in vehicles on 16/32/64. I play alot of infantry and the best maps for that are Sharqi Peninsula, Mashtuur City and Strike at Karkand. Shongua Stalemate is my favourite chinese map and is also ok as inf map. There are lots of places to take cover from hardware.
